How to Update the Native System Unit File
When working with packages, updating the native system unit file is a crucial task that requires attention to detail and careful execution. In this blog post, we will walk you through the steps involved in updating the native system unit file in your package.
The native system unit file serves as a central component in your package, controlling how the package interacts with the system and other packages. Updating this file correctly ensures that your package remains compliant with the latest standards and functions optimally in various environments.
To begin updating your native system unit file, you first need to assess the current state of the file and identify any areas that require modification or enhancement. This can involve checking for deprecated functions, optimizing code for performance, or adding new features to keep up with evolving requirements.
